Background
-
Function
Transmembrane Protein 9B enhances production of pro-inflammatory cytokines induced by TNF, IL1B, and TLR ligands. Has a role in TNF activation of both the NF-kappaB and MAPK pathways
-
Subcellular Localization
Lysosome membrane; Single-pass membrane protein; Early endosome membrane; Single-pass membrane protein
